Which planet has clouds that rain diamonds?

It literally rains diamonds on Neptune and Uranus.

Extreme pressure deep inside these ice giants crushes methane into solid diamonds. These gemstones then sink through the atmosphere like glittering hailstones. Scientists have even recreated this process on Earth using high-powered lasers.

Deep within the atmospheres of Neptune and Uranus, temperatures reach thousands of degrees and pressures are millions of times greater than on Earth. These extreme conditions break apart methane molecules, which consist of one carbon atom and four hydrogen atoms. Once the carbon is isolated, the intense pressure compresses it into a crystalline form, creating solid diamonds.Researchers from the SLAC National Accelerator Laboratory first confirmed this phenomenon in 2017 using the Linac Coherent Light Source X-ray laser. By applying heat and pressure to polystyrene, a material that mimics the hydrocarbon structure of methane, they observed the formation of nanodiamonds in real-time. This experiment proved that carbon can transition into a solid diamond state within the specific environments of ice giant planets.Once formed, these diamonds are thought to be much larger than the microscopic versions created in labs, potentially reaching millions of carats in weight. Because diamonds are denser than the surrounding hydrogen and helium fluids, they slowly sink toward the planetary core. This process, often called diamond rain, may generate additional heat through friction as the stones descend through the mantle.This discovery helps explain why Neptune is much hotter than predicted by standard planetary models. The energy released by the falling diamonds contributes to the planet's internal heat budget. Similar processes may occur on other gas giants and exoplanets throughout the galaxy, making diamond rain a potentially common cosmic occurrence.
